[gem5-dev] changeset in gem5: ext: clang fix for flexible array members

2014-08-13 Thread Mitch Hayenga via gem5-dev
changeset 0edd36ea6130 in /z/repo/gem5 details: http://repo.gem5.org/gem5?cmd=changeset;node=0edd36ea6130 description: ext: clang fix for flexible array members Changes how flexible array members are defined so clang does not error out during compilation. diffstat:

[gem5-dev] changeset in gem5: sim: remove kernel mapping check for baremeta...

2014-08-13 Thread Dam Sunwoo via gem5-dev
changeset 3ea92bc6393b in /z/repo/gem5 details: http://repo.gem5.org/gem5?cmd=changeset;node=3ea92bc6393b description: sim: remove kernel mapping check for baremetal workloads Baremetal workloads are specified using the kernel parameter, but don't always have the correct

[gem5-dev] changeset in gem5: util: Fix state leakage in the SortIncludes s...

2014-08-13 Thread Andreas Sandberg via gem5-dev
changeset 84b4d6af0ecc in /z/repo/gem5 details: http://repo.gem5.org/gem5?cmd=changeset;node=84b4d6af0ecc description: util: Fix state leakage in the SortIncludes style verifier There are cases where the state of a SortIncludes object gets messed up and leaks between

[gem5-dev] changeset in gem5: scons: Build the branch predictor for all CPUs

2014-08-13 Thread Andreas Sandberg via gem5-dev
changeset c7187ee80868 in /z/repo/gem5 details: http://repo.gem5.org/gem5?cmd=changeset;node=c7187ee80868 description: scons: Build the branch predictor for all CPUs The branch predictor is normally only built when a CPU that uses a branch predictor is built. The list of

[gem5-dev] changeset in gem5: base: Remove unused M5_PRAGMA_NORETURN

2014-08-13 Thread Andreas Sandberg via gem5-dev
changeset ef888b246cd0 in /z/repo/gem5 details: http://repo.gem5.org/gem5?cmd=changeset;node=ef888b246cd0 description: base: Remove unused M5_PRAGMA_NORETURN The M5_PRAGMA_NORETURN macro was only used in for __exit_message. Since the macro only holds a stub definition and

[gem5-dev] changeset in gem5: power: Remove unused private members to fix c...

2014-08-13 Thread Andreas Sandberg via gem5-dev
changeset faa9dfc465ef in /z/repo/gem5 details: http://repo.gem5.org/gem5?cmd=changeset;node=faa9dfc465ef description: power: Remove unused private members to fix compile-time warning Certain versions of clang complain about unused private members if they are not used.

[gem5-dev] changeset in gem5: scons: Silence clang 3.4 warnings on Ubuntu 1...

2014-08-13 Thread Andreas Sandberg via gem5-dev
changeset 362875aec1ba in /z/repo/gem5 details: http://repo.gem5.org/gem5?cmd=changeset;node=362875aec1ba description: scons: Silence clang 3.4 warnings on Ubuntu 12.04 This changeset fixes three types of warnings that occur in clang 3.4 on Ubuntu 12.04: *

[gem5-dev] changeset in gem5: cpu: Don't forward declare RefCountingPtr

2014-08-13 Thread Andreas Sandberg via gem5-dev
changeset 4cbfdcdb2144 in /z/repo/gem5 details: http://repo.gem5.org/gem5?cmd=changeset;node=4cbfdcdb2144 description: cpu: Don't forward declare RefCountingPtr RefCountingPtr is sometimes forward declared to avoid having to include refcnt.hh. This does not work since we

[gem5-dev] changeset in gem5: mips: Remove unused private members to fix co...

2014-08-13 Thread Andreas Sandberg via gem5-dev
changeset 5b67e1bdf6ad in /z/repo/gem5 details: http://repo.gem5.org/gem5?cmd=changeset;node=5b67e1bdf6ad description: mips: Remove unused private members to fix compile-time warning Certain versions of clang complain about unused private members if they are not used. This

[gem5-dev] RFC: New include file ordering

2014-08-13 Thread Andreas Sandberg via gem5-dev
Hi Everyone, I have a change I'd like to make to the gem5 coding style that I believe will improve our code quality. Currently, the gem5 coding style mandates that includes are grouped four different blocks (alphabetical ordering within a block): * Python headers * C system/stdlib includes

[gem5-dev] Review Request 2324: sim: bump checkpoint version for multiple event queues

2014-08-13 Thread Andreas Hansson via gem5-dev
--- This is an automatically generated e-mail. To reply, visit: http://reviews.gem5.org/r/2324/ --- Review request for Default. Repository: gem5 Description --- Changeset

[gem5-dev] Review Request 2327: arm: support 16kb vm granules

2014-08-13 Thread Andreas Hansson via gem5-dev
--- This is an automatically generated e-mail. To reply, visit: http://reviews.gem5.org/r/2327/ --- Review request for Default. Repository: gem5 Description --- Changeset

[gem5-dev] Review Request 2325: mem: Fix address interleaving bug in DRAM controller

2014-08-13 Thread Andreas Hansson via gem5-dev
--- This is an automatically generated e-mail. To reply, visit: http://reviews.gem5.org/r/2325/ --- Review request for Default. Repository: gem5 Description --- Changeset

[gem5-dev] Review Request 2331: style: Add support for a style ignore list and ignore ext/

2014-08-13 Thread Andreas Hansson via gem5-dev
--- This is an automatically generated e-mail. To reply, visit: http://reviews.gem5.org/r/2331/ --- Review request for Default. Repository: gem5 Description --- Changeset

[gem5-dev] Review Request 2330: style: Fixup strange semantics in hg m5style

2014-08-13 Thread Andreas Hansson via gem5-dev
--- This is an automatically generated e-mail. To reply, visit: http://reviews.gem5.org/r/2330/ --- Review request for Default. Repository: gem5 Description --- Changeset

[gem5-dev] Review Request 2333: arm: Mark v7 cbz instructions as direct branches

2014-08-13 Thread Andreas Hansson via gem5-dev
--- This is an automatically generated e-mail. To reply, visit: http://reviews.gem5.org/r/2333/ --- Review request for Default. Repository: gem5 Description --- Changeset

[gem5-dev] Review Request 2336: arm: ISA X31 destination register fix

2014-08-13 Thread Andreas Hansson via gem5-dev
--- This is an automatically generated e-mail. To reply, visit: http://reviews.gem5.org/r/2336/ --- Review request for Default. Repository: gem5 Description --- Changeset

[gem5-dev] Review Request 2332: cpu: Fix cached block load behavior in o3 cpu

2014-08-13 Thread Andreas Hansson via gem5-dev
--- This is an automatically generated e-mail. To reply, visit: http://reviews.gem5.org/r/2332/ --- Review request for Default. Repository: gem5 Description --- Changeset